Before you start, it is important to have a solar panel installation diagram that outlines the layout and connection of the panels. This diagram will serve as a blueprint for your project, helping you plan the placement of each panel and ensure an efficient and effective installation. The flexible racking system uses low-relaxation steel strands instead of the conventional section purlin brackets to carry PV modules, and the low-frequency vibration of the structure has less impact on PV modules. Adjustable tilt kits are mounting structures designed to raise and angle solar panels on roofs where the existing pitch is not optimal for solar production. Solar panel mounting brackets made from GI-channel steel (Galvanized Iron) are widely used in photovoltaic installations due to their high strength, corrosion resistance, and durability.
